From: Simon Cross Date: Sun, 11 May 2014 17:09:37 +0000 (+0200) Subject: Add missing state arguments to scene __init__s. X-Git-Tag: 0.1~401 X-Git-Url: https://git.ctpug.org.za/?p=naja.git;a=commitdiff_plain;h=0c2f24f460b34fc558eedbd448a4c35415cb60d6 Add missing state arguments to scene __init__s. --- diff --git a/naja/scenes/credits.py b/naja/scenes/credits.py index 46c076f..a1c7d8f 100644 --- a/naja/scenes/credits.py +++ b/naja/scenes/credits.py @@ -13,8 +13,8 @@ class CreditsScene(Scene): base_menu = None - def __init__(self): - super(CreditsScene, self).__init__() + def __init__(self, state): + super(CreditsScene, self).__init__(state) self.widgets.append(TextWidget((60, 10), 'Credits', fontsize=32, colour='white')) self.widgets.append(TextWidget((60, 30), diff --git a/naja/scenes/game.py b/naja/scenes/game.py index d6d558c..e37b63e 100644 --- a/naja/scenes/game.py +++ b/naja/scenes/game.py @@ -20,8 +20,8 @@ class GameScene(Scene): Gameboard scene. """ - def __init__(self): - super(GameScene, self).__init__() + def __init__(self, state): + super(GameScene, self).__init__(state) self.widgets.append(PlayerBitsWidget((0, 0))) self.widgets.append(BoardWidget((0, 60))) self.widgets.append(GameBitsWidget((0, 540))) diff --git a/naja/scenes/menu.py b/naja/scenes/menu.py index 6819810..9a0fe71 100644 --- a/naja/scenes/menu.py +++ b/naja/scenes/menu.py @@ -13,8 +13,8 @@ from naja.events import SceneChangeEvent class MenuScene(Scene): - def __init__(self): - super(MenuScene, self).__init__() + def __init__(self, state): + super(MenuScene, self).__init__(state) self.widgets.append(TextWidget((10, 10), 'Game', fontsize=32, colour='white')) self.widgets.append(TextWidget((10, 40), 'Credits', fontsize=32,